What does u0022fill dirtu0022 mean for projects in Eagle Lake, FL?
Fill dirt is inexpensive subsoil used to raise grades, fill low spots, and build non-structural berms. In Eagle Lake it usually comes from locally sourced pits and reflects Polk County's sandy, clay-mixed soils, so color and texture vary by supplier. Fill dirt is not the same as topsoil or structural engineered fill used under foundations.

How many tons of fill dirt do I need to raise my yard by a certain depth?
A good estimating rule is 1 cubic yard of fill dirt equals about 1.3 tons. For a 1,000 sq ft area, expect roughly 4 tons to raise it 1 inch, 8 tons for 2 inches, about 24 tons for 6 inches, and about 48 tons for 12 inches. These are approximate—sandy native soils in Polk County can affect yield, so use our material calculator or request help for a project-specific estimate.

What type of fill mix is best for drainage and compaction on sandy Eagle Lake lots?
For general grading on sandy Polk County lots, a well-graded fill with a mix of sand and some clay/fines compacts better than pure sand and reduces settle. If drainage is a priority, place a coarse layer (clean sand or crushed stone) below finished grade and slope the site away from structures. For load-bearing work near buildings, pools, or garages, use engineered fill specified by a geotechnical engineer with compaction testing.
How do heavy rain and tropical storms affect fill dirt in Eagle Lake?
Intense rain and storm runoff can cause erosion, washouts, and increased settling of loose fill, especially on slopes or where compaction was limited. Eagle Lake's sandy soils and occasional high water table increase this risk, so proper compaction, temporary erosion controls, and grading to direct water away are important. For storm-prone projects, add erosion control measures like silt fencing, mulch, or vegetation while the fill stabilizes.
Do I need permits to bring and place fill dirt in Polk County or Eagle Lake?
Permit needs depend on the scope and location of the work. Small landscaping fills often do not require a permit, but projects that alter drainage, change finished grade near neighboring properties, occur in floodplains or wetlands, or involve street dumping may need permits from Polk County or the City of Eagle Lake. Contact Polk County Building and Permitting and the City of Eagle Lake before starting work to confirm requirements.

Is washed fill dirt better than unwashed for residential driveways near Eagle Lake?
Fill dirt—washed or unwashed—is not typically the right surface material for driveways. Washed material has fewer fines and drains better but does not compact as well for a stable base; unwashed fill dirt compacts more but can retain moisture and rut. For driveways in Eagle Lake, a proper base of crushed stone or aggregate base followed by a suitable surface material is recommended rather than relying on fill dirt alone.
Can I use fill dirt instead of engineered fill under pools or foundations in Eagle Lake?
No. For structural loads like pools or building foundations you should use engineered fill specified by a geotechnical engineer with required compaction and testing. Fill dirt is fine for non-structural grading and raising low spots, but it is not a substitute for engineered fill or recommended geotechnical procedures in Polk County. Ask your contractor or a geotechnical engineer to specify materials and compaction requirements before placing any structural fill.
What delivery or placement challenges should I expect in West Florida and Eagle Lake?
Common issues include limited access for tri-axle dump trucks, soft or wet ground that can bog trucks down, low-hanging trees or utility lines, and narrow driveways that prevent direct dumping. Drivers may need to dump on the street, which can require a local permit or neighbor coordination, and tailgate spreading is at the driver's discretion. To avoid problems, clear a path, confirm access measurements with the hauler, and note any site restrictions in Order Notes when you place your Hello Gravel order.
